Il 11/12/2011 23:10, Lorenzo Bettini ha scritto:
Then I run again make and make install, but the changes I made are not
copied to /usr/local. I mean: lang.map misses my edit and there's no
lilypond.lang

mh... that should not happen... are you sure that make install complete
successfully...  and that (after make install) you're actually running
the installed source-highlight executable (please try 'which
source-highlight').  Note also that source-highlight starts searching
for its files in the current directory.  You may want to check the lang
files source-highlight is actually handling by running it with the
command line option --lang-list


'which source-highlight' gave /usr/local/bin as path
I tried also --lang-list but it was not listed

Please, also consider that, when developing a new language, and in
general, you can avoid installing: you can use the command line option
--data-dir of source-highlight to force it to use the files (.lang, .map).


I'll go this way.
Actually, I'll run this command to test (in the directory where I have my new language file):

source-highlight -s lilypond.lang -i test.ly -o test.html

Finally, if you add a .lang file in the lang.map file, if you want to
install it, you'll also have to modify Makefile.am by adding your .lang
file to the installed ones (you can take a look at src/Makefile.am).


I think that's what I was missing.
